adac | any idea what this problem might be about? https://i.imgur.com/s2T7xra.png hapening to me on 16.04 with proxmox | 09:06 |
TJ- | adac: ATA SFF is the legacy ATA IDE interface, and it looks like the device is erroring in a way the kernel cannot handle | 09:28 |
adac | TJ-, thank you! Is there a way I can find out what exactly it is causing it? | 09:37 |
adac | I now upgraded the kernel everywhere | 09:37 |
TJ- | adac: Clues, if any, should be in the kern.log | 09:41 |
adac | TJ-, Had a look at it, but it doesn't seem be written out actually | 09:47 |
TJ- | adac: is the BUG happening during early boot time? | 09:47 |
adac | TJ-, actually the host was running for quite some time. Then at some point it was not responsive anymore | 09:48 |
adac | and then I had a lookk at proxmox vpn view | 09:48 |
adac | where I got this error | 09:48 |
TJ- | adac: so there should be kernel logging then | 09:48 |
TJ- | the only time logging won't be available is at early boot before the file-system containing /var/log/ is mounted read-write, or at shutdown | 09:49 |
adac | TJ-, this is booting up log or? https://gist.github.com/anonymous/705067de0b94127485abcaa1d26fff31 | 09:49 |
TJ- | adac: yes, usually /var/log/kern.log | 09:50 |
adac | TJ-, yes and before this booting up log entries I tried to search for an error but there seems to be none | 09:51 |
adac | is there a good way to search for errors? | 09:51 |
adac | in the log file | 09:51 |
TJ- | adac: reading is the only way :) | 09:51 |
adac | hehe ok | 09:51 |
adac | I mean I'd expect the error right before the reboot, or? | 09:52 |
TJ- | adac: basic procedure is locate the boot-up entries after the system restarted and work backwards. You'd expect any clues to be just before the new-boot messages | 09:52 |
adac | *reboot entries | 09:52 |
adac | exactly | 09:52 |
adac | but there is noe | 09:52 |
adac | none | 09:52 |
TJ- | adac: but sometimes they could have happened some time ago, rather than being Bang! Snap! Drat! Oh! BUG! | 09:53 |
adac | hehe ok I will scroll up again a bit then :) | 09:53 |
adac | brb | 09:53 |
TJ- | adac: I'd focus on the ATA devices attached, check their SMART status (smartctl), and so on | 09:54 |
